## Why PDF Translation Differs from Standard Document Localization
Unlike editable formats such as DOCX or XLSX, PDFs are designed for fixed-layout presentation, not linguistic manipulation. When translating from Portuguese to German, content teams encounter several structural constraints:
– **Non-linear text extraction:** Portuguese sentences often follow Subject-Verb-Object structures with flexible adjective placement, while German relies on strict verb positioning, compound noun construction, and case-driven syntax. Direct extraction without context mapping frequently breaks grammatical coherence.
– **Layout displacement:** German text typically expands by 10–30% compared to Portuguese. Tables, callouts, footnotes, and multi-column layouts often overflow, requiring Desktop Publishing (DTP) intervention.
– **Embedded fonts and encoding:** Many Portuguese PDFs use Latin-1 or specific regional encodings (e.g., ISO-8859-1 for PT-BR). German requires proper Ü, Ä, Ö, and ß rendering. Font substitution without glyph mapping results in missing characters or corrupted symbols.
– **Security and permissions:** Encrypted, digitally signed, or form-enabled PDFs restrict extraction and modification, requiring specialized parsing or permission negotiation.
Understanding these constraints is essential before evaluating translation methodologies.
## Technical Architecture: How PT→DE PDF Translation Works Under the Hood
Modern PDF translation pipelines operate through a multi-stage technical architecture:
1. **Document Parsing & Text Isolation:** The system identifies text layers, vector objects, images, and form fields. Scanned PDFs require OCR (Optical Character Recognition) with language-specific models trained on Portuguese typography and Germanic character sets.
2. **Metadata & Context Extraction:** Headers, footers, annotations, bookmarks, and hyperlinks are mapped to preserve navigation structure. Technical tags (XML, PDF/UA accessibility markers) are isolated for compliance.
3. **Translation Memory (TM) & Terminology Alignment:** Enterprise-grade platforms match segments against pre-approved glossaries (e.g., legal terms, engineering nomenclature, marketing brand voice). Portuguese variants (PT-PT vs. PT-BR) are normalized before German localization (DE-DE, DE-AT, DE-CH).
4. **Layout Reconstruction & DTP:** Translated text is reflowed using automated typesetting algorithms or manual DTP tools. Line breaks, hyphenation rules (German uses extensive compound splitting), and pagination are adjusted to maintain visual parity.
5. **Validation & Export:** The output is validated against ISO standards (PDF/A for archiving, PDF/UA for accessibility), spell-checked with German Duden-compliant dictionaries, and cross-referenced with original formatting.
This architecture explains why off-the-shelf machine translation often fails with complex PDFs: it addresses only the linguistic layer, ignoring structural, typographic, and compliance requirements.
## Comparative Review: Four Approaches to Portuguese-to-German PDF Translation
Business teams typically evaluate four primary methodologies. Below is an objective review of each, focusing on accuracy, technical capability, scalability, and enterprise suitability.
### 1. Pure Machine Translation (MT) Engines
Standard MT platforms (Google Translate, DeepL, Microsoft Translator) offer rapid, low-cost translation by processing text segments through neural models.
**Strengths:** Near-instant turnaround, minimal upfront cost, suitable for internal drafts or high-volume low-stakes documents.
**Weaknesses:** Ignores PDF layout, struggles with German compound nouns and Portuguese idioms, fails on OCR-heavy or secured files, zero compliance validation, requires manual reformatting.
### 2. AI-Enhanced PDF Translation Platforms
Modern SaaS solutions combine neural MT with layout-aware parsing, automated DTP, and terminology management. Examples include specialized localization platforms with PDF-specific modules.
**Strengths:** Preserves formatting, handles OCR, supports glossary integration, reduces manual DTP by 60–80%, scalable API integration for content pipelines.
**Weaknesses:** Subscription costs scale with volume, requires initial glossary setup, AI may still misinterpret highly regulated or technical Portuguese phrasing without human review.
### 3. Professional Human Translation + Desktop Publishing (DTP)
Traditional localization agencies provide certified linguists for PT→DE translation, followed by manual layout reconstruction using InDesign, FrameMaker, or PDF editors.
**Strengths:** Highest accuracy for legal, financial, and technical content, native German stylistic compliance, certified translations accepted by courts and regulatory bodies, precise DTP control.
**Weaknesses:** Slow turnaround (days to weeks), high per-page cost, coordination overhead between translators and layout specialists, difficult to scale for dynamic content.
### 4. Hybrid Enterprise Workflow (AI + Human + CAT Integration)
The most advanced approach integrates AI preprocessing, computer-assisted translation (CAT) environments, terminology databases, and targeted human review. Content teams use platforms like SDL Trados, memoQ, or enterprise localization suites with PDF connectors.
**Strengths:** Balances speed and accuracy, leverages translation memory for consistency, enables collaborative review workflows, supports version control, audit-ready for compliance.
**Weaknesses:** Requires initial infrastructure investment, demands trained localization managers, complex setup for cross-functional teams.

## Optimized Workflow for Enterprise Content Teams
Content teams managing Portuguese to German PDF translation should implement a standardized pipeline to ensure consistency, reduce rework, and maintain compliance.
**Phase 1: Source Preparation**
– Audit source PDFs for security restrictions, embedded fonts, and scan quality.
– Convert locked files to editable formats if necessary, preserving original structure.
– Extract text into a CAT-compatible format (XLIFF, TMX) while maintaining layout references.
**Phase 2: Terminology & Style Alignment**
– Implement a Portuguese-German bilingual glossary covering domain-specific terms (e.g., manufacturing, SaaS, healthcare, legal).
– Define regional preferences: PT-BR vs. PT-PT, DE-DE vs. Swiss German vs. Austrian German.
– Configure style guides for formal register (Sie-form in German), technical precision, and brand voice.
**Phase 3: Translation & QA**
– Process through AI or human translation with TM leverage.
– Run automated QA checks: number formatting (German uses commas for decimals, dots for thousands), date formats (DD.MM.YYYY), unit conversions, and hyperlink integrity.
– Perform linguistic review for German syntax, compound word correctness, and Portuguese source fidelity.
**Phase 4: Layout Reconstruction & Export**
– Use DTP tools or automated reflow engines to adjust text boxes, tables, and graphics.
– Validate against PDF/A or PDF/UA standards if required.
– Apply digital signatures or watermarking for version control.
**Phase 5: Integration & Archival**
– Store localized PDFs in a digital asset management (DAM) system with metadata tagging.
– Sync translation memory for future updates.
– Establish versioning protocols to track revisions across language pairs.

## Best Practices for Quality Assurance & Compliance
To maximize ROI and minimize localization risk, content teams should adopt these proven practices:
– **Implement Bilingual Glossaries Early:** Portuguese technical terms often lack direct German equivalents. Pre-defining mappings prevents inconsistent usage across documents.
– **Enforce German Formatting Rules:** Decimals, dates, addresses, and legal phrasing differ significantly. Automated QA scripts should validate these before export.
– **Use Translation Memory Strategically:** Leverage 100% matches for repetitive sections (headers, disclaimers, footers) to accelerate turnaround and reduce costs.
– **Conduct Contextual Reviews:** Isolated sentence translation fails with technical or legal PDFs. Provide translators with full-document context and reference materials.
– **Validate Accessibility Compliance:** German regulations increasingly require barrier-free digital documents. Ensure localized PDFs pass PDF/UA validation for screen reader compatibility.
– **Maintain Audit Trails:** Track translator credentials, QA approvals, and version history. Essential for regulated industries and internal governance.

**Q: How does German text expansion affect PDF layout?**
A: German typically expands by 10–30% compared to Portuguese. This requires automated or manual text box adjustment, font scaling, and pagination review to prevent overflow and maintain visual consistency.
**Q: Do I need certified translations for business PDFs?**
A: Legal contracts, regulatory filings, court documents, and official certifications require certified human translation with sworn translator credentials. Marketing and internal materials typically do not.
